Document Transport — Spare Parts Runs to Cray Hollow Station

Spare parts for the Cray Hollow remote site travel with the weekly document pouch, not as separate freight. The shift lead checks each part against the requisition sheet, seals items in padded transit cases, and records the case numbers in the transport log. Cases must be loaded last and unloaded first at the relay point. Any discrepancy halts the run. The courier hand-over instruction applying to these cases appears below.

courier memo of fadug-tajop: the gorir sorael courier leaves the istys ledger at gate 1509 under passcode 497843

## Greenquill Wiki — Environment Variables for RBAC

The Greenquill wiki enforces role-based access through the authz sidecar, not application code. Roles (reader, editor, steward) map to groups synced hourly from the Hatchford directory. If permissions look stale, restart the sidecar rather than editing role tables directly — manual edits are overwritten on the next sync. The sidecar reads its configuration from /opt/greenquill/authz.env. Group sync requires a directory credential, which is set on the line below:

sealed setting: LEDGER_TOKEN5=bcca1

## Digest Scheduling

The Mossbury digest scheduler batches outbound summaries hourly. Cron windows are defined in `schedule.toml`; never edit live, always redeploy. Duplicate sends are prevented by the ledger table — if it drifts, pause the worker before reconciling. Retries cap at three with exponential backoff. Releases go through the Halloway pipeline, and every build artifact is signed before rollout. When verifying a deploy, check the artifact signature against the key shown below.

deploy key for kajof-fajop: bky6_gDHw9Q